PEOPLE v. BHOJE


275 A.D.2d 419 (2000)

712 N.Y.S.2d 876

THE PEOPLE OF THE STATE OF NEW YORK, Respondent, v. MOHAN BHOJE, Appellant.

Appellate Division of the Supreme Court of the State of New York, Second Department.

Decided August 21, 2000.


Ordered that the judgment is affirmed.

The stop of the vehicle occupied by the defendant in temporal and physical proximity to the crime was proper. The vehicle matched the victims' description of the getaway vehicle and a passenger matched the description of one of the robbers (see, People v Torres, 262 A.D.2d 161; People v Ryan, 224 A.D.2d 644).
